2. El Teniente Copper Mine: The El Teniente copper mine is the world’s largest underground copper mine. Located near Rancagua, the mine is a great place to explore and learn about the history of copper mining in Chile. Visitors can take tours of the mine and learn about the history and science of copper mining.
